CARP – A precautionary boil water advisory has been issued for some users of the Carp communal well water system because of a watermain break.
The advisory affects about 180 water users for all the addresses on the following streets:
-Carp Highlands Court
-3849 – 3894 Carp Road
-Charlie’s Lane
-Hidden Lake Crescent
-Juanita Avenue
-Ridgeview Drive
-Seagram Heights
-Snelgrove Drive
You’re asked to bring water to a rolling boil for at least one minute before using it for all consumption purposes, including drinking, making juice, ice and infant formula, as well as for use in food preparation.
After boiling, the water should be left to cool before being used, or it should be placed in clean containers to cool in the refrigerator.
Boiled water should be used when brushing teeth and to rinse dishes after washing. Other non-consumption uses, such as showering, are safe.
If you are unable to boil water, you should consume only bottled water.
The break was caused by private construction activity and has been isolated for repair by City crews. The advisory is in effect until further notice.
